Does BMW Ventilation Heat the Car?

Featured image for: Does BMW Ventilation Heat the Car?
Spread the love

Yes, BMW ventilation systems are designed to provide heat to the car’s interior. The ventilation system works in conjunction with the heating unit to circulate warm air throughout the cabin, ensuring that the occupants stay comfortable during colder weather. Understanding how this system operates can help you optimize your vehicle’s heating efficiency and comfort level.

How the Heating Process Works

black BMW TurboPower engine bay

The heating process in BMW vehicles typically begins with the engine coolant heating up. Once the engine reaches its optimal operating temperature, coolant circulates through the heater core, which is essentially a small radiator located within the cabin. The blower motor then pushes air from the cabin or outside through this heater core, allowing the warm coolant to transfer heat to the air. As the air passes through, it becomes warmer and is blown out of the vents into the cabin. This process not only helps in heating the car but also maintains a comfortable climate by adjusting based on passenger preferences. Moreover, many BMWs come equipped with a timer function that allows the heating system to warm the vehicle before the driver even arrives, which is particularly useful in cold climates.

Common Issues with BMW Heating Systems

The BMW logo is prominently displayed.

Like any mechanical system, BMW heating systems can encounter issues that affect their performance. One common problem is the buildup of debris or dust in the ventilation system, which can reduce airflow and efficiency. Another frequent issue is a malfunctioning thermostat, which can prevent the engine from reaching the necessary temperature to heat the coolant effectively. Additionally, leaks in the coolant system can lead to insufficient heating, as the coolant may not circulate properly. Regular maintenance, including checking coolant levels and cleaning the ventilation system, can help prevent these issues. Understanding these potential problems will allow BMW owners to take proactive measures to maintain their heating systems effectively.

User Controls and Settings

a close up of the bmw logo on a car

BMW vehicles come equipped with a range of user-friendly controls to manage the heating and ventilation systems. Most models feature a digital climate control interface that allows drivers to set specific temperatures for different zones within the vehicle. Some BMWs also offer a ‘max heat’ setting that quickly warms the cabin when needed. Additionally, features like heated seats and steering wheels can enhance comfort during colder months. For tech-savvy users, many newer BMW models have integrated smart technology that allows for remote adjustments via smartphone apps, enabling users to pre-heat their vehicles before entering. Frequently Asked Questions

How long does it take for BMW heating to work?

Typically, it takes about 5 minutes for the heating system to start delivering noticeable warmth, depending on outside temperatures and engine conditions.

Can I control the heating remotely?

Yes, many modern BMW models come with a remote start feature that allows you to preheat the vehicle from a smartphone app.

What should I do if my heating system isn’t working?

If your heating system is not working, check the coolant levels, inspect for any leaks, and ensure the thermostat is functioning correctly. It may be necessary to consult a professional for further diagnostics.

Is it safe to use the heating system while driving?

Yes, it is safe to use the heating system while driving, and it can help maintain comfort and visibility by preventing fogging on the windows.
